AI-Generated Summary

The Right Ricky Sanchez podcast recaps a pivotal Game 2 victory for the Philadelphia 76ers over the Boston Celtics, tying the series 1-1. Hosts Spike Eskin and Mike Levin celebrate the team's improved execution, particularly the standout performances of rookie VJ Edgecombe and Maxey, who played with aggression and poise despite missing Joel Embiid. The Sixers’ balanced attack, disciplined passing, and defensive intensity—especially in the second half—were highlighted as key factors in overcoming Boston’s early momentum. The hosts praise the team’s mental toughness, reduced turnovers, and strategic use of minutes, noting that Maxey’s 39-minute effort was sustainable due to better rotation depth. They also spotlight Justin Edwards’ impactful role after Edgecombe’s injury, and commend Paul George’s defensive presence and playmaking. Despite concerns over Embiid’s status, the hosts express cautious optimism about his potential return, emphasizing that the team’s growth and resilience are more important than the outcome of individual games. The episode closes with lighthearted banter about the hosts’ personal lives, including Spike’s upcoming nose surgery and a post-game hangover, while encouraging listeners to stay engaged with the series.

Key Takeaways
1

VJ Edgecombe delivered a historic rookie playoff performance, becoming the youngest player in NBA history with a 30-point, 10-rebound game in the playoffs.

2

The Sixers’ offensive efficiency improved dramatically with crisp passing, timely three-point shooting, and reduced turnovers compared to Game 1.

3

Maxey’s aggressive playmaking and ability to draw fouls and create space were critical, especially when paired with Edgecombe’s scoring burst.

4

Defensive discipline and rebounding intensity—particularly in the second half—allowed the Sixers to clamp down on Boston’s offense and control the tempo.

5

The team’s depth, especially from Justin Edwards and Grimes, proved vital when key players were sidelined, showing the value of a balanced rotation.
